Glorious Galicia

Misty and mild in contrast to the semi-arid interior, this section of Spain has a similar climate to Britain, New Zealand, or the Pacific Northwest. Though that means sunbathing isn't often on the bingo card in Galicia, the beach offers beautiful views of the jagged granite coastline and open Atlantic beyond. Indeed, watching the seas is something of an industry here: Galicia's coast boasts 44 lighthouses across its many inlets and islets.
